We are not in a slow market. Houses in Shaughnessy Park are selling in an average of 10 days, and buyers are paying 109.66% of the list price. That means if a home is listed at $174,900, it's closing closer to $192,000. That's not a typo.
Our neighbourhood ranks 10th out of 71 in Winnipeg for days-on-market speed. That puts us in the very fast-selling category across the city. For context on price, we rank 168 out of 185 - meaning we are still one of the more affordable options in Winnipeg. That combination - affordable and fast-moving - is exactly what draws buyers in.
On the rental side, the numbers hold up too. Estimated rent sits at $1,520 per month with a rental yield of 6.01%. For anyone thinking about holding a property as an investment, that is a strong return.
